**Mgmt Meeting Minutes — Retiring the Brightline Range**

Quick recap for sales leads at Fenholt Supplies: we agreed to retire the Brightline fixture range by year-end. Remaining stock moves to clearance pricing next month, and accounts on standing orders get migrated to the Lumetta range. Trade-in incentives were approved in principle. The confidential note on next steps sits just below.

board note of bajof-bajeg: The pricing group signed off on a budget of $13.4 million for Project Sildor. The renewal with Lamixek Holdings closes at $48.9 million a year, 49 percent above the last contract.

Load tests for the Cartquill checkout flow use synthetic sessions minted by the Forgebench harness. Sessions expire after 15 minutes; the harness refreshes them automatically. Real customer sessions are never replayed. All synthetic traffic is tagged with an x-loadtest header so fraud rules skip it. Runs target the isolated perf cluster only. Authenticate harness requests using the bearer token below.

session JWT of yawep-yawep = eyJhbGciOiJIUzI1NiIsInR5cCI6IkpXVCJ9.eyJzdWIiOiI3pWF3_In0.aXYsHiog

Finance Review Summary — Support Outsourcing (Q3)

For branch managers: the review of the Corvalux support outsourcing plan shows projected annual savings of 14% after transition costs. Vendor Quillhaven Ops met all benchmark targets. Severance provisions are fully accrued. Branch-level budgets will be adjusted next quarter. Before adjustments are circulated, note the confidential planning item appended directly below this summary.

internal memo for kaduf-baduf: Only 35 of the 378 pilot accounts renewed Holir, so a churn review is set for June 11. Eliielax Group is in early talks to buy Silaelix Group for about $142.1 million.

Action item: The Relayn deploy-status bot silently dropped updates when the pipeline API paginated results, so responders believed a rollback had completed when it had not. We will add pagination handling, a staleness banner, and an integration test. Until merged, verify deploy state directly in the pipeline console, documented at the page below.

runbook for kahop-kajop: https://rundeck.ordinio.test/display/secrets/pipeline/issue/pages/repo/browse/e5732776e07d1285107e5aeb